Abstract

A thermometer includes an illuminated display, which may act as an intelligent indicator of the change and level of temperature. The thermometer includes memory unit accommodating multiple users and their past records respectively. When a new temperature reading is obtained, the thermometer compares the new temperature against the immediate preceding record of the same user. The thermometer further includes a display module indicating the change of temperature reading and the fever status of the user.
